I am trying to connect Oracle with VBA using connection string OraOLEDB.Oracle and it is throwing an error Provider not found

  • MS Office 365 - 64 bit
  • Oracle 11g - 64 bit
  • Windows7 - 64 bit

It is not possible for me to switch to 32 bit.

You need to get the 64-bit OLEDB driver installed. Repair your Oracle installation or download it from here.
